Cotswold Based Public Relations Agency Scoops Respected Industry Award
Cotswold based 10 Yetis Public Relations has won a respected PR industry Gold award that was judged by peers from across the sector, for a campaign to promote a product invented in Gloucestershire.
10 Yetis Public Relations, based in Pullman Court in Gloucester, has won a Chartered Institute of Public Relations Award in the West of England Region for the category of
Best Campaign £10k and Under
The award was for the media campaign that the Agency ran to promote Gloucestershire-based inventor Vivian Blick’s H20 Shower Powered Radio.
Coverage for the campaign spanned across every media, including; television such as ITV, BBC, Discovery Channel and Scottish TV, every national newspaper, influential online media such as the BBC Website, Crunch Gear and Tech Radar and respected magazines such as Wired, FT How to Spend it, and Nuts magazine.
The CIPR West of England Awards were held on Friday 21 October at The Bristol Hotel.
